Darrang, Feb. 8 -- Assam Congress chief Gaurav Gogoi on Sunday accused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ma of raking up old allegations of anti-national activities against him as the issue of 12,000 bighas of land is coming to the fore, with people coming out and wanting to see a new Bor Assam.
He said that the "Samay Parivartan Yatra" exposes the alleged 12,000-bigha land grab.
"Earlier, I also said that this will flop; this is not a flop, it is a super flop. He (Sarma) intended to say this on September 10, but he fell asleep for 6 months afterwards.
